All the Rage is a monthly podcast from Drs. Ryan Martin and Chuck Rybak at the University of Wisconsin-Green Bay. From toxic masculinity to internet trolls to human trafficking, All the Rage covers all topics related to anger and violence.

Global Village PodCast is launching Memorial Day Friday from Menominee, MI at the Marina on Green Bay. Our mission slogan is "Recovering people helping people recover". The founders are Waldo Walding and Lauren Mitchell, both 40 year FCC veteran programmers for TV networks, Radio Station clusters and entertainment. Both retired now, GVP is a non-profit pending group functioning as a free-form style 70's - todays FM radio conglomerate, without the obligation of commerciality or stress. Listen ...
